• TAPE END appears when the end
of the tape is reached during
recording or a cassette is inserted
with its tape already at the end.
INDEX and FADE
• INDEX flashes when an index mark
is being recorded. Details are on
page 30.
• FADE appears when you press the
F1 button to select the fade feature
and flashes when fade is activated.
Details are on page 38.
